Posted By: Reginald Culpepper on October 20, 2020 Xavier University of Louisiana's Angela Charles-Alfred and Lailaa Bashir repeated as ITA Cup NAIA doubles champion with a 3-6, 7-6 (7-5) 6-4 victory against Georgia Gwinnett's second-seeded Maria Genovese amd Eva Siska. Earlier Sunday, Bashir lost 6-2, 7-6 (7-0) to top-seeded Genovese in the singles final. The doubles victory was the 17th in a row for Charles-Alfred and Bashir, both left-handers. They beat Genovese in the ITA Cup NAIA final for the second straight year. In 2019 Charles-Alfred and Bashir trailed 4-1 before winning 6-4, 6-4 victory against Genovese and Madeline Bosnjak. Bashir, a sophomore, is 14-1 this fall, winning all seven of her doubles matches and 7-of-8 singles matches. Her two-season XULA combined record is 60-5. Bashir also earned the ITA Cup's James O'Hara Sargent Sportsmanship Award, which is given to singles main-draw finalists who display outstanding sportsmanship and exemplify the spirit of college tennis during the course of the ITA Cup. Genovese was No. 2 in the end-of-season ITA singles rankings of 2019-20, but in doubles she's 0-3 in her career against Charles-Alfred and Bashir.
